In The Poetic Turing Test for AI, William G. Brockman presents a groundbreaking paradigm shift in AI safety and evaluation. While traditional benchmarks test for logic and facts, this book argues that poetry-with its ambiguity, metaphor, and emotional resonance-is the ""kryptonite"" that exposes the true limitations and hidden dangers of modern AI. This isn't just literary theory; it is a handbook for the future of AI safety. Drawing on extensive research and case studies involving ChatGPT and Google Gemini, this book reveals how the subtle art of verse can be weaponized to bypass safety filters, or used as a diagnostic tool to prove true comprehension. Inside, you will discover: The Metaphorical Trojan Horse: How harmful ideologies can be smuggled past AI safety guardrails using beautiful, figurative language that machines fail to flag. The Syntactic Maze: How breaking grammatical norms exposes the fragility of an AI's logic and reasoning capabilities. The Persona Trap: Why AI models are susceptible to adopting dangerous worldviews when seduced by a persuasive, poetic voice. A New Evaluation Framework: Why we need to move beyond ""accuracy"" scores and start measuring ""emotional resonance"" and ""metaphorical coherence.""
